Midnight Sherpa | Star Citizen | Invictus 2951

In a repeat engagement with Cloud Imperium Games to promote Invictus launch week, Midnight Sherpa pushed even deeper into the Star Citizen universe. Repurposing 3D game assets, the cinematic trailer was interspersed with epic space battle scenes showcasing the complexity of the systems tech used by the UEE fleet. A UI ecosystem was created to imagine what every facet of naval navigation and weaponry systems might look like in the year 2951.

Our team took the existing cartography and supplementary mission data from the game and re-imagined them through the lens of sci-fi design. Condensing the Star Citizen playable universe into a digestible dimensional star map, then constructing a UI design system for the UEE Naval fleet. Fortunately Star Citizen has amassed an incredible trove of branding elements to incorporate including logo marques for ship manufactures and style guides for military branches all adding to the richness of the final design.


In keeping with a trend popular in real life military recruitment marketing, theses cut away scenes give us a glimpse of the mission planning and supporting data system that drive a military objective. The war map itself or ‘Hub’ becomes a narrative device to seamlessly move between missions giving the audience a satellite view of the interest zones and a window into the strategy of a UEE Navy military campaign.
